后端架构优化:资讯系统编译与性能提升
|
本结构图由AI绘制,仅供参考 在资讯系统开发中,后端架构的稳定性与响应速度直接影响用户体验。随着数据量和并发请求的增长,传统单体架构逐渐暴露出瓶颈,编译效率低下、部署复杂、扩展困难等问题日益突出。因此,对后端架构进行优化成为提升系统性能的关键一步。编译阶段的优化从构建工具入手。采用更高效的构建工具如Gradle或Webpack,配合增量编译机制,可显著减少重复编译时间。同时,合理拆分模块,将高频变更部分独立为子模块,使每次修改仅触发相关部分重新编译,避免全量重建带来的资源浪费。 在代码层面,通过引入异步处理与非阻塞I/O模型,能够有效缓解高并发场景下的线程阻塞问题。使用Netty或Spring WebFlux等响应式框架,不仅提升了吞吐量,还降低了内存占用,使系统在面对突发流量时更具韧性。 数据库是资讯系统的核心瓶颈之一。通过建立合理的索引策略、查询语句优化以及读写分离架构,可大幅降低数据访问延迟。引入Redis等缓存中间件,将热点数据预加载至内存,实现毫秒级响应,减轻数据库压力。 部署方面,容器化技术如Docker与Kubernetes的应用,使服务部署更加标准化与自动化。微服务架构下,各组件独立部署、弹性伸缩,既提升了系统的可维护性,也增强了整体容错能力。结合CI/CD流水线,实现快速迭代与零停机发布。 性能监控同样不可忽视。集成Prometheus与Grafana等工具,实时追踪接口响应时间、错误率与系统负载,帮助快速定位性能瓶颈。日志结构化处理与链路追踪(如SkyWalking)则让问题排查变得直观高效。 本站观点,后端架构优化并非单一环节的改进,而是从编译、代码、数据库、部署到监控的全链路协同优化。持续投入技术升级,才能确保资讯系统在海量数据与高并发场景下依然稳定、高效运行。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

